U.S. tightens visa regulations for international students, exchange visitors and journalists

๐Ÿ“Œ Summary:

  • The U.S. Department of Homeland Security (DHS) has tightened visa rules for foreign students, exchange visitors and journalists, ending a decades-old policy that let them stay indefinitely under "duration of status" without periodic government oversight
  • The new rules establish a fixed period of admission for non-immigrant holders of F (students), J (exchange visitors) and I (media) visa classifications
  • Large impact on Indians, who form one of the biggest cohorts of international students and exchange visitors in the U.S.; they will now face fixed stay limits and renewal/extension requirements
  • Reflects a broader tightening of U.S. immigration policy affecting Indian diaspora, students and skilled-mobility flows
  • Raises concerns over uncertainty and compliance burden for Indian students planning long-duration programmes
